site stats

Linq expression group by

Nettet21. sep. 2024 · In LINQ, join operations are performed on sequences of objects whose elements are different types. After you have joined two sequences, you must use a select or group statement to specify which element to store in the output sequence. Nettet31. jan. 2024 · LINQ group by in Entity Framework Core 3.1. I have a database table to connect data between user and clients. db: class UserClientCorporate { int UserId; User User; int ClientCorporateId; ClientCorporate ClientCorporate; } I want to query to get list of ClientCorporates grouped by userid.

Create a nested group (LINQ in C#) Microsoft Learn

Nettet在 LINQ 中,GroupBy 运算符用于根据键的指定值对列表/集合项进行分组,并返回 IGrouping 的集合。 LINQ 中的 GroupBy 方法与 SQL group by 语句相同。 LINQ GroupBy () 方法的语法 下面是使用 LINQ GroupBy () 方法根据键的指定值对元素进行分组的语法。 var student1 = objStudent. GroupBy (x => x.Location); 根据上述语 … Nettet2. des. 2013 · I am trying to do a GroupBy using Dynamic LINQ but have trouble getting it to work. This is some sample code illustrating the problem: List listAlbums = new List(); for (int i = 0; i < 5000; i++) { dtoMyAlbum album = new dtoMyAlbum { Author = "My Author", BookID = i, CurrSymbol = "USD", Price = 23.23, … mat tim thai https://garywithms.com

C# LINQ Query with dynamic operators - Stack Overflow

Nettet7. apr. 2024 · GroupBy is a LINQ functionality which allows to group items from a collection based on a given key. It’s an equivalent to SQL’s GROUP BY clause. In this article we’ll show various examples of usage, starting from the simplest grouping by one key, through grouping by multiple keys, custom result selector and all of that in two ... Nettet18. feb. 2024 · The basic technique in each example is to group the source elements by using a continuation named newGroup, and then generating a new subquery against newGroup. This subquery is run against each new group that is created by the outer query. Note that in this particular example the final output is not a group, but a flat … Nettet21. mai 2024 · Processing of the LINQ expression 'GroupByShaperExpression ... RelationalProjectionBindingExpressionVisitor' failed #21446 smitpatel The LINQ expression could not be translated 21 hidden items Load more… roji mentioned this issue on Feb 10, 2024 Narrow the feature gap between EF Core and EF6 #24106 Open 28 … herewithin definition

Query expression basics (LINQ in C#) Microsoft Learn

Category:LINQ GroupBy()用法及代码示例 - 纯净天空

Tags:Linq expression group by

Linq expression group by

Dynamically Build LINQ Expressions Developer for …

NettetFind the best open-source package for your project with Snyk Open Source Advisor. Explore over 1 million open source packages. Nettet19. apr. 2024 · If your data looks like the list below you can group by the compound key then take the first value in each group. The OrderBy is optional. var groupUsers = new List () { new { groupId = 1, userId = 1, name = "a" }, new { groupId = 1, userId = 1, name = "b" }, new { groupId = 1, userId = 2, name = "c" } }; var result ...

Linq expression group by

Did you know?

Nettetfor 1 dag siden · Actually the productGroupFilterValue is being queried with == . But the user have the option in the GUI to select between "Equals" ( == ), "Greater than" ( &gt;=) and "Contains". The selected operator option is part of the filter object and called filter.Operator. Is there a way to implement this in my LINQ query dynamically? Many thanks for any help! Nettet2. jun. 2024 · Grouping is a very powerful feature provided by LINQ that transforms a collection in groups where each group has a key associated with it. Note: GroupBy performs a deferred execution which means the query is only executed when the records are processed using a foreach loop.

Nettet12. jul. 2024 · using System; using System.Linq; using System.Collections.Generic; ... var result = await data.GroupBy(d =&gt; new { d.C1, d.C2 }) //Group by C1 and C2 .Select(s =&gt; s.First()) //Select first record from each Group .Skip(1) //Skip first record .Take(4) //Pick up next 4 records .ToListAsync() //Convert 4 records to List. Nettet9. aug. 2024 · Processing of the LINQ expression '' by 'NavigationExpandingExpressionVisitor' failed #21727 Translate GroupBy followed by FirstOrDefault over group #12088 Grouping by Date Parts #22008 smitpatel removed their assignment on Jan 12, 2024 added the on Mar 10, 2024 noe555 mentioned this …

Nettet10. feb. 2016 · var groupedData = outputTable.AsEnumerable () .GroupBy (x =&gt; new { name = x.Field ( "name" ), source = x.Field ( "source" ), destination = x.Field ( "destination") }).ToList (); this works but source and destination could be anything that I pull from the database as I need to make these groupings dynamic. Nettet3. jun. 2024 · LINQ can be written using one of two syntaxes: query syntax (shown above) or method syntax. The two syntaxes are semantically identical and the one you use depends on your preference. The same …

LINQ group by expression syntax Ask Question Asked 13 years, 4 months ago Modified 9 years, 10 months ago Viewed 46k times 49 I've got a T-SQL query similar to this: SELECT r_id, r_name, count (*) FROM RoomBindings GROUP BY r_id, r_name I would like to do the same using LINQ. So far I got here:

Nettet9. mai 2024 · The LINQ expression '(GroupByShaperExpression: KeySelector: (j.AccountId), ElementSelector:(EntityShaperExpression: EntityType: JournalVoucherLine ValueBufferExpression: (ProjectionBindingExpression: EmptyProjectionMember) IsNullable: False ) ).FirstOrDefault()' could not be translated. mattimore bootsNettet15. sep. 2024 · Grouping refers to the operation of putting data into groups so that the elements in each group share a common attribute. The following illustration shows the results of grouping a sequence of characters. The key for each group is the character. The standard query operator methods that group data elements are listed in the … mattina center officeNettet8. mar. 2013 · Construct a LINQ GroupBy query using expression trees. I have stuck on this problem for a week and no solution found. public class Journal { public int Id { get; set; } public string AuthorName { get; set; } public string Category { get; set; } public DateTime CreatedAt { get; set; } } I want to know during a specific date span ... herewithin or herewithNettetBy default, the GroupBy method in LINQ will exclude any elements that have a null key from the groups. However, you can modify this behavior by specifying a custom IEqualityComparer that treats null keys as distinct values. Here's an example of how to use GroupBy to include null values as a group: csharpclass MyClass { public int? here within these walls lyricsmatt in breath of the wildNettet9. jun. 2024 · // 动态创建 GroupBy 中的 Expression ParameterExpression pe = Expression.Parameter ( typeof (Person), "p" ); MemberExpression meGender = Expression.Property (pe, "Gender" ); Expression> groupByExpression = Expression.Lambda> (meGender, pe); // 动态创建 Select 中的 Expression Type … mattinas sheridanNettetWith LINQ, this is very easy, even though the use of the GroupBy () method can be a bit confusing in the beginning. Let's have a look at how it works: using System; using System.Collections.Generic; using System.Linq; namespace LinqGroup { class Program { static void Main (string [] args) { var users = new List () { mattina healthcare